Pulqueriajalatlaco
Pulqueria Jalatlaco on Aldama serves traditional pulques and curados (tuna, mango, apio) with a small botana, the most local-feeling drink room in the barrio.
Signature drink: Pulque curado de tuna
Food: Botana
Mezcal cocktail barcentro-historico
Sabina Sabe on Cinco de Mayo 209 is named for Mazatec medicine woman Maria Sabina, a cocktail bar with one of the world's largest mezcal collections.
Signature drink: Sabina Sabe house cocktail
Food: Snacks and small plates
Cocktail barcentro-historico
Selva on Macedonio Alcala is on the 50 Best Discovery list, a creative cocktail bar with Oaxacan-ingredient drinks and mezcals from small distilleries.
Signature drink: Selva cocktail with mezcal, hoja santa and Oaxacan cheese
Food: Bar snacks
